def _specs_with_commits(spec):
has_commit_var = "commit" in spec.variants
has_git_version = isinstance(spec.version, vn.GitVersion)
if not (has_commit_var or has_git_version):
return
# Specs with commit variants
# - variant value satsifies commit regex
# - paired to a GitVersion or can create GitVersion from version that was selected
# - variant value should match GitVersion's commit value
if has_commit_var:
invalid_commit_msg = (
f"Internal Error: {spec.name}'s assigned commit {spec.variants['commit'].value}"
" does not meet commit syntax requirements."
)
# TODO probably want a more specific function just for sha validation
assert vn.is_git_version(spec.variants["commit"].value), invalid_commit_msg
# Specs with GitVersions
# - must have a commit variant, or add it here
# - must have a commit on the GitVersion (enforce after look up implemented)
if has_git_version:
if not spec.version.commit_sha:
# TODO(psakiev) this will be a failure when commit look up is automated
return
spec.variants["commit"] = vt.SingleValuedVariant("commit", spec.version.commit_sha)
